Ingredients:
For Base
½ cup butter
26 Oreo biscuits, crushed
For Filling
2 cups cream cheese
½ cup icing sugar
1 cup white chocolate, chunks
1 + ½ cup whipping cream
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

We all love New York Cheesecake. This dense cheesecake is heavenly, and I absolutely love it. My recipe contains sour cream which adds acidity and I think it achieves a nice overall balance.
▶NY Cheesecake◀
Quantity: For one cheesecake of 15cm diameter
All ingredients need to be at room temp (approx. 20°C).
⊙Biscuit Base⊙
Digestive biscuits 80g
Melted butter 35g
Crush the biscuits, mix it with melted butter and push it down inside the pan. Bake at 175℃ for 12~15mins.
⊙Cheesecake filling⊙
Cream Cheese 300g
Vanilla bean just a bit
Sugar 90g
Eggs 60g
Cake flour 10g
Heavy Cream 60g
Sour cream 80g
① Lightly beat the cream cheese.
② Add sugar + vanilla seeds and continue beating.
③ Gradually add the eggs.
④ Add the heavy cream.
⑤ Sift in the cake flour and mix.
⑥ Finally add in the sour cream and mix well.
⑦ Bake at 170°C for 40~50mins (Pre-heat to 170°C)
How to store: Store in the fridge up to 3 days, freezer up to 2 weeks.

SUPER EASY Burnt Basque Cheesecake Recipe | Cupcake Jemma Channel
Do you get scared of baking Cheesecakes? Well fear no more! This Basque style cheesecake is all the things we usually avoid - it's BURNT, it's CRACKED, it's SUNK... and its utterly delicious! Invented in the Basque country this Cheesecake has no biscuit base, instead you get the slightly crisp texture and amazing caramelised flavour from the burnt crust. If you prefer a slightly looser centre feel free to bake for around 40-45 minutes rather than the 50 minutes as stated in the video.

----------
8 Cake Tin
600g Cream Cheese at room temp
225g Caster Sugar
4 Eggs Pinch of Salt
300g Double Cream (heavy cream)
1 tsp Vanilla Extract ((Get yours here ))
40g Plain Flour
